Introduction
What are threads?
●

●

A thread is a light-weight process
A thread of execution is the smallest sequence of programmed
instructions that can be managed independently by an operating
system scheduler
process
Time

A process with two threads of execution on a single processor.
●

for example copying a file and showing the progress, or playing
a music while showing some pictures as a slideshow, or a
listener handles cancel event for aborting a file copy operation
●

Multithreading generally occurs by time- division multiplexing.

●

The processor switches between different threads

●

●

●

●

●

On a multiprocessor or multi-core system, threads can be truly 
concurrent, with every processor or core executing a separate thread 
simultaneously.
Many modern operating systems directly support both time-sliced and 
multiprocessor threading with a process scheduler.
The scheduler is an operating system module that selects the next 
jobs to be admitted into the system and the next process to run.
The kernel of an operating system allows programmers to manipulate 
threads via the system call interface
Multi-threading is a widespread programming and execution model 
that allows multiple threads to exist within the context of a single 
process

Python Threading:
●

●

●

A thread has a beginning, an execution sequence, and a conclusion. It has an instruction 
pointer that keeps track of where within its context it is currently running.
    it can be pre-empted (interrupted)
    It can temporarily be put on hold (also known as sleeping) while other threads are running  
   this is called yielding.

Starting a New Thread:
To spawn another thread, you need to call following method available in thread module:
thread.start_new_thread ( function, args[, kwargs] )
●

●

The method call returns immediately and the child thread starts and calls function with the 
passed list of args. When function returns, the thread terminates.
Here, args is a tuple of arguments; use an empty tuple to call function without passing any 
arguments. kwargs is an optional dictionary of keyword arguments.
EXAMPLE:

#!/usr/bin/python
import thread
import time
# Define a function for the thread
def print_time( threadName, delay):
count = 0
while count < 5:
time.sleep(delay)
count += 1
print "%s: %s" % ( threadName, time.ctime(time.time()) )
# Create two threads as follows
try:
thread.start_new_thread( print_time, ("Thread-1", 2, ) )
thread.start_new_thread( print_time, ("Thread-2", 4, ) )
except:
print "Error: unable to start thread"
while 1:
pass
When the above code is executed, it produces the following result:

Thread-1: Tue Sep  3 10:10:38 2013
Thread-2: Tue Sep  3 10:10:40 2013
Thread-1: Tue Sep  3 10:10:40 2013
Thread-1: Tue Sep  3 10:10:42 2013
Thread-1: Tue Sep  3 10:10:44 2013
Thread-2: Tue Sep  3 10:10:44 2013
Thread-1: Tue Sep  3 10:10:46 2013
Thread-2: Tue Sep  3 10:10:48 2013
Thread-2: Tue Sep  3 10:10:52 2013
Thread-2: Tue Sep  3 10:10:56 2013
The Threading Module:
●

●

The newer threading module included with Python 2.4 provides much more 
powerful, high-level support for threads than the thread module discussed in the 
previous section.
The threading module exposes all the methods of the thread module and provides 
some additional methods:
threading.activeCount(): Returns the number of thread 
objects that are active.
threading.currentThread(): Returns the number of thread 
objects in the caller's thread control.
threading.enumerate(): Returns a list of all thread objects 
that are currently active.
In addition to the methods, the threading module has the Thread class that
implements threading.
The methods provided by the Thread class are as follows:
run(): The run() method is the entry point for a thread.
start(): The start() method starts a thread by calling the run method.
join([time]): The join() waits for threads to terminate.
isAlive(): The isAlive() method checks whether a thread is still executing.
getName(): The getName() method returns the name of a thread.
setName(): The setName() method sets the name of a thread.
Creating Thread using Threading Module:
To implement a new thread using the threading module, you have to do the
following:
●

Define a new subclass of the Thread class.

●

Override the __init__(self [,args]) method to add additional arguments.

●

●

Then, override the run(self [,args]) method to implement what the thread should
do when started.

Once you have created the new Thread subclass, you can create an instance of it and
then start a new thread by invoking the start(), which will in turn call run() method.
EXAMPLE:
#!/usr/bin/python
import threading
import time
exitFlag = 0
class myThread (threading.Thread):
def __init__(self, threadID, name, counter):
threading.Thread.__init__(self)
self.threadID = threadID
self.name = name
self.counter = counter
def run(self):
print "Starting " + self.name
print_time(self.name, self.counter, 5)
print "Exiting " + self.name
def print_time(threadName, delay, counter):
While counter:
if exitFlag:
thread.exit()
time.sleep(delay)
print "%s: %s" % (threadName,
time.ctime(time.time()))
counter -= 1
# Create new threads
thread1 = myThread(1, "Thread-1", 1)
thread2 = myThread(2, "Thread-2", 2)
# Start new Threads
thread1.start()
thread2.start()
print "Exiting Main Thread"

Synchronizing Threads:
●

●

●

●

●

●

The threading module provided with Python includes a simple-toimplement locking mechanism that will allow you to synchronize threads
A new lock is created by calling the Lock() method, which returns the new
lock.
The acquire(blocking) method of the new lock object would be used to
force threads to run synchronously
The optional blocking parameter enables you to control whether the
thread will wait to acquire the lock.
If blocking is set to 0, the thread will return immediately with a 0 value if
the lock cannot be acquired and with a 1 if the lock was acquired. If
blocking is set to 1, the thread will block and wait for the lock to be
released.
The release() method of the the new lock object would be used to release
the lock when it is no longer required.
EXAMPLE:
#!/usr/bin/python
import threading
import time
class myThread (threading.Thread):
def __init__(self, threadID, name, counter):
threading.Thread.__init__(self)
self.threadID = threadID
self.name = name
self.counter = counter
def run(self):
print "Starting " + self.name
# Get lock to synchronize threads
threadLock.acquire()
print_time(self.name, self.counter, 3)
# Free lock to release next thread
threadLock.release()
def print_time(threadName, delay, counter):
while counter:
time.sleep(delay)
print "%s: %s" % (threadName,
time.ctime(time.time()))
counter -= 1
threadLock = threading.Lock()
threads = []
# Create new threads
thread1 = myThread(1, "Thread-1", 1)
thread2 = myThread(2, "Thread-2", 2)
# Start new Threads
thread1.start()
thread2.start()
# Add threads to thread list
threads.append(thread1)
threads.append(thread2)
# Wait for all threads to complete
for t in threads:
t.join()
print "Exiting Main Thread"
